
K Annamalai Quits BJP, Party Says 'No Loss'
K Annamalai, BJP's most recognizable face in Tamil Nadu, resigned from the party after disagreements with top leadership over the future of Tamil Nadu politics. He stated that national parties do not speak the language understood by people in Tamil Nadu and he will start a movement to contest the next state election. Nitin Nabin, BJP's National President, accepted his resignation. The Andhra Pradesh BJP chief expressed hope for Annamalai's return to the party in the future.
